The Research Institute for Spirituality and Health (FISG) in Langenthal has spent two decades exploring the scientific links between faith and well-being. Founded by Swiss physician René Hefti, the institute has demonstrated through numerous studies that spirituality can strengthen identity, foster gratitude, and improve coping with illness and crisis.
